#314098 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#314098 is composed of 19.2% red, 25.1%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 67.8% cyan, 57.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 231.3 degrees, a saturation of 51.2% and a lightness of 39.4%. #314098 color hex could be obtained by blending #6280ff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#333399.

Shades and Tints of #314098

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010204 is the darkest color, while #f4f5f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#314098

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5f616a is the less saturated color, while #031fc6 is the most saturated one.
